Strategic Material Selection Guide for nylon windbreaker pants
Analysis of Common Materials for Nylon Windbreaker Pants
1. Nylon (Polyamide)
Nylon, or polyamide, is the most prevalent material used in windbreaker pants due to its excellent balance of weight, strength, and weather resistance. It offers high tensile strength, making it durable against tearing and abrasion, which is essential for outdoor and activewear applications. Nylon fabrics are inherently lightweight, facilitating ease of movement and comfort, especially in active or travel scenarios.
From a performance perspective, nylon is highly resistant to water and wind, especially when treated with durable water repellent (DWR) coatings. Its flexibility allows for comfortable fit and ease of layering, which appeals to consumers in diverse climates. However, nylon’s susceptibility to UV degradation can be a concern in prolonged outdoor exposure, requiring UV stabilizers during manufacturing.
In terms of manufacturing, nylon is relatively straightforward to process via standard textile techniques such as weaving and knitting, making it cost-effective for mass production. It also lends itself well to various finishes, including waterproofing and breathability enhancements. For international buyers, nylon complies with numerous standards like ASTM and ISO, and it is generally accepted across markets, although specific certifications (e.g., OEKO-TEX) may be desirable for eco-conscious segments.
2. Polyester
Polyester is another common synthetic fiber used in windbreaker pants, often blended with nylon or used independently. It boasts excellent durability, resistance to stretching, shrinking, and most chemicals, which ensures longevity in demanding environments. Polyester fabrics are also highly resistant to UV rays, which prolongs the lifespan of the product in outdoor conditions.
From a performance standpoint, polyester can be engineered to be highly water-resistant and quick-drying, making it suitable for rain-resistant windbreaker pants. It is generally less expensive than nylon, offering a cost advantage for large-scale imports. However, pure polyester may be less breathable than nylon, which can impact comfort during prolonged wear, especially in hot climates.
For international B2B buyers, polyester’s widespread acceptance is reinforced by compliance with global standards such as OEKO-TEX and REACH. It is particularly favored in regions like Africa and South America where affordability and durability are critical. Manufacturers often apply eco-friendly finishes to meet environmental regulations prevalent in Europe and the Middle East, aligning with market preferences for sustainable products.
3. Ripstop Nylon
Ripstop nylon is a variation of nylon fabric woven with a reinforced grid pattern, typically using thicker threads. This construction significantly enhances tear and puncture resistance, making it ideal for rugged outdoor applications, including windbreaker pants designed for hiking or military use.
The key advantage of ripstop nylon is its exceptional durability without a significant weight penalty. It maintains the lightweight and weather-resistant properties of standard nylon but with added resilience. Its high strength-to-weight ratio makes it suitable for high-performance outdoor gear, especially in regions prone to rough terrain or demanding conditions.
The main limitation is higher manufacturing complexity and cost, which can be a concern for bulk imports aimed at price-sensitive markets. Ripstop nylon also tends to be less breathable unless specially treated, which can impact comfort in hot climates. For buyers in Europe and the Middle East, compliance with standards like ISO and DIN for outdoor gear durability is common, and ripstop nylon often exceeds these requirements.
4. Polyester/Nylon Blends
Blended fabrics combining polyester and nylon aim to leverage the strengths of both fibers—nylon’s durability and polyester’s cost-effectiveness and UV resistance. These blends can be engineered to optimize breathability, water resistance, and durability, depending on the specific application.
From a manufacturing perspective, blending allows for customization of fabric properties, which can be tailored to regional climatic conditions. For example, in African and South American markets, where cost and durability are paramount, blends can provide a balanced solution. In Europe and the Middle East, eco-friendly and certified blends are increasingly preferred, aligning with sustainability standards.
However, blending can complicate recycling processes and may require specific certifications to meet environmental standards. Buyers should verify the composition and compliance of blended fabrics to ensure they meet regional regulations and consumer expectations.

In-depth Look: Manufacturing Processes and Quality Assurance for nylon windbreaker pants
Manufacturing Processes for Nylon Windbreaker Pants
The production of nylon windbreaker pants involves a series of meticulously planned stages, each critical to ensuring product quality, durability, and compliance with international standards. For B2B buyers, understanding these processes helps in selecting reliable suppliers and verifying product consistency.
Material Preparation and Procurement
The process begins with sourcing high-quality nylon fabric, typically made from nylon 6 or nylon 6,6 polymers, known for their strength, lightweight nature, and wind-resistant properties. Suppliers often pre-treat or laminate the fabric with waterproof or water-resistant coatings such as polyurethane (PU) or silicone to enhance performance. Material certification—such as OEKO-TEX Standard 100 or GRS (Global Recycled Standard)—provides assurance of safety and sustainability, especially critical for European and Middle Eastern markets.
Fabric Forming and Cutting
Once the raw fabric is procured, it undergoes quality inspection (IQC – Incoming Quality Control) to verify specifications, including weight, weave density, and coating integrity. The fabric is then cut into pattern pieces using computer-controlled cutting machines, ensuring precision and minimal waste. For international buyers, verifying the cutting accuracy and adherence to pattern specifications is vital to prevent inconsistencies in sizing and fit.
Assembly and Sewing
The cut pieces are assembled through a series of sewing operations, often employing industrial sewing machines with specialized stitches like reinforced or bartack stitches for stress points. Seam sealing—using heat or adhesive tapes—is a common step to enhance water resistance. The assembly process may also include attaching zippers, elastic waistbands, drawstrings, and reflective elements, with each component tested for durability and adherence to safety standards.
Finishing and Surface Treatments
Post-assembly, the pants undergo finishing processes such as heat-setting to stabilize fabric dimensions, and surface treatments like DWR (Durable Water Repellent) application. These treatments are critical for performance and are tested for longevity through wash and abrasion tests. For exports, finishing standards may include compliance with OEKO-TEX or bluesign certifications, indicating environmentally friendly processes.
Quality Control Protocols
Robust quality assurance is fundamental for nylon windbreaker pants, particularly given the varying environmental conditions faced in target markets across Africa, South America, the Middle East, and Europe.
International Standards and Industry-Specific Certifications
- ISO 9001: Most reputable manufacturers operate under ISO 9001 quality management systems, ensuring consistent process control, documentation, and continuous improvement.
- OEKO-TEX Standard 100: Ensures textiles are free from harmful substances, vital for European and Middle Eastern markets with strict regulations.
- REACH Compliance: For European buyers, compliance with REACH ensures chemicals used in coatings and dyes meet safety standards.
- Environmental Certifications: Certifications like bluesign or GRS demonstrate environmentally sustainable manufacturing, increasingly valued in global markets.
Quality Control Checkpoints
- IQC (Incoming Quality Control): Verifies raw materials meet specifications before production begins. Checks include fabric weight, coating integrity, color consistency, and chemical safety.
- IPQC (In-Process Quality Control): Conducted during manufacturing, focusing on seam integrity, stitching quality, fabric tension, and coating adherence. Random sampling ensures ongoing compliance.
- FQC (Final Quality Control): Performed at the end of production, inspecting finished garments for defects such as uneven seams, coating flaws, or incorrect labeling. Functional testing—water repellency, wind resistance, and durability—is also included.
Testing Methods
- Water Resistance Testing: Hydrostatic head tests evaluate fabric waterproofness, crucial for windbreaker performance.
- Breathability and Wind Resistance: ASTM standards or ISO tests measure fabric permeability and wind-blocking capabilities.
- Abrasion and Durability Tests: Martindale or Taber tests assess fabric resistance to wear.
- Colorfastness: Ensures color stability after washing, exposure to light, and environmental factors.
- Stretch and Flexibility Tests: Confirm fabric and seams withstand movement without failure.

Comprehensive Cost and Pricing Analysis for nylon windbreaker pants Sourcing
Cost Components for Nylon Windbreaker Pants
Understanding the comprehensive cost structure is essential for effective negotiation and margin management when sourcing nylon windbreaker pants. The primary cost components include:
-
Materials: High-quality nylon fabric, often ripstop or plain weave, constitutes the bulk of material costs. Specialized coatings for wind resistance, water repellency, or breathability can significantly influence prices, especially if certification or eco-friendly standards are required. For bulk orders, material costs per unit typically range from $2 to $6, depending on quality and specifications.
-
Labor: Manufacturing labor costs vary widely by country. In Asian production hubs like China or Vietnam, labor may be as low as $0.50 to $2 per garment, whereas factories in Eastern Europe or Turkey might charge between $2 to $4. Efficient factories with high output and automation can reduce per-unit labor costs, but these savings may be offset by higher compliance or certification expenses.
-
Manufacturing Overhead: Overhead includes factory utilities, machinery depreciation, and management costs. These are often embedded in the per-unit price but can range from $0.50 to $1.50 depending on the factory’s efficiency and location.
-
Tooling and Development: Initial mold, pattern, and sample development costs are generally amortized over large production volumes. For standardized nylon windbreaker pants, tooling might add $200 to $500 per style, but this cost diminishes per unit with higher order quantities (e.g., 10,000+ units).
-
Quality Control (QC): Rigorous QC processes, especially for certifications like ISO, Oeko-Tex, or environmental standards, can add $0.20 to $0.50 per garment. Reliable suppliers with established QC protocols tend to include these costs within their unit price.
-
Logistics and Incoterms: Shipping costs depend on weight, volume, and destination. Air freight, suitable for urgent or small shipments, can cost $3 to $8 per kg, while sea freight might be $0.50 to $2 per kg for bulk orders. FOB (Free on Board) terms are common, transferring responsibility to the buyer after loading, but C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) includes insurance and freight, affecting landed costs.
-
Profit Margin: Suppliers typically add a margin of 10-25% depending on their market position, order volume, and relationship with the buyer. Larger, repeat orders often secure more favorable margins.
Price Influencers and Variability Factors
Several factors influence the final pricing of nylon windbreaker pants:
-
Order Volume & MOQ: Higher volumes significantly reduce per-unit costs due to economies of scale. Many suppliers require minimum order quantities (MOQs) ranging from 500 to 5,000 units, which directly impacts pricing. Buyers should aim for larger orders to negotiate better unit prices.
-
Specifications & Customization: Features such as waterproof coatings, reflective elements, or branding increase costs. Customization, including size ranges, color options, or special fabrics, can also elevate unit prices by 10-20%.
-
Material Quality & Certifications: Premium fabrics with eco-certifications or enhanced durability command higher prices. Certification costs may also be passed down, adding to the overall expense.
-
Supplier Factors: Established suppliers with good reputations, certifications, and reliable delivery histories tend to charge higher prices but offer better quality assurance. Emerging manufacturers may offer lower prices but pose higher risks regarding quality and compliance.
-
Incoterms & Shipping: FOB pricing is common, but buyers should consider additional costs like freight, insurance, and customs duties. Understanding local import tariffs and VAT is crucial for accurate landed cost estimation.
Buyer Tips for International Sourcing
-
Negotiate Total Cost of Ownership (TCO): Focus not only on unit price but also on shipping, customs, lead times, and after-sales support. A slightly higher unit cost may be offset by lower logistics or faster delivery.
-
Leverage Volume & Long-Term Relationships: Building trust with suppliers can unlock discounts, flexible MOQs, and favorable payment terms. Bulk purchasing and consistent orders incentivize suppliers to offer better rates.
-
Understand Pricing Nuances: Suppliers may price differently based on order size, payment terms, and delivery schedules. Clarify whether prices are FOB, CIF, or DDP to accurately compare offers.
-
Assess Quality & Certification Costs: Investing in certified fabrics or sustainable materials may increase initial costs but can enhance brand reputation and compliance with international standards, reducing risks of customs delays or product recalls.
-
Factor in Local Import Duties & Taxes: For buyers in Africa, South America, or the Middle East, import tariffs can range from 5% to 20% or higher. Include these in your TCO calculations to avoid surprises.
Indicative Price Range
Given current market conditions and supplier variability, the typical FOB price for nylon windbreaker pants ranges from $7 to $15 per unit for orders exceeding 1,000 units. Smaller orders or customized specifications may push prices higher, up to $20 or more per piece. These figures are indicative; actual prices depend on the specific supplier, quality requirements, and order volume.

Essential Technical Properties and Trade Terminology for nylon windbreaker pants
Critical Technical Properties for Nylon Windbreaker Pants
1. Material Composition and Grade
The core material for nylon windbreaker pants is typically high-density nylon (e.g., 6,6 nylon), chosen for its durability, lightweight nature, and resistance to tearing. Industry-grade nylon used in B2B manufacturing often conforms to specific standards such as ASTM or ISO, ensuring consistent quality. For buyers, understanding the grade helps assess the product’s longevity, weather resistance, and suitability for various climates—key factors for end-users in regions like Africa, South America, or Europe.
2. Water Resistance and Breathability Ratings
Nylon fabrics are often treated with durable water repellent (DWR) coatings to enhance water resistance. Technical specifications such as hydrostatic head (measured in mm) indicate the fabric’s ability to withstand water pressure, with higher values signifying better waterproofing. Simultaneously, breathability ratings (e.g., RET or moisture vapor transmission rate) ensure moisture vapor escapes, preventing internal condensation. These properties are vital for outdoor and active wear, directly impacting product performance and customer satisfaction.
3. Tensile Strength and Tear Resistance
Tensile strength measures how much pulling force a fabric can withstand before breaking, typically expressed in Newtons per meter (N/m). Tear resistance indicates how well the fabric resists ripping when subjected to stress. For B2B buyers, these specs guarantee that the nylon will endure rugged outdoor conditions, reducing returns and warranty claims, especially in markets with high outdoor activity levels like Brazil or Egypt.
4. Fabric Weight and Thickness
Fabric weight, expressed in ounces per square yard or grams per square meter (gsm), influences the windbreaker’s packability, durability, and weight. Lightweight options (around 1-2 oz) are preferred for ultralight activities, whereas slightly heavier fabrics offer increased durability. Precise control over thickness ensures consistency across production batches, critical for meeting performance standards and customer expectations.
5. Colorfastness and UV Resistance
Colorfastness refers to the fabric’s ability to retain color after exposure to washing, rubbing, or sunlight. UV resistance, often specified as UPF ratings, indicates how well the fabric protects against ultraviolet rays. These properties are essential for outdoor gear in sunny regions, ensuring longevity and maintaining aesthetic appeal, which influences brand reputation and repeat sales.

3. What are typical minimum order quantities, lead times, and payment terms for sourcing nylon windbreaker pants internationally?
MOQ requirements vary by supplier but generally range from 500 to 3,000 pairs for nylon windbreaker pants, especially for customized orders. Lead times typically span 4 to 8 weeks, depending on order complexity, customization, and production capacity. Standard payment terms include 30% deposit upfront with the remaining balance payable before shipment, or letters of credit for larger transactions. Some suppliers may offer flexible terms for repeat customers or bulk orders. Negotiate payment terms early, and consider using secure payment platforms or escrow services to mitigate risks associated with international transactions.
